Kids Ministry

SOUTHCOAST Kids is a place where children learn to live out their faith, build lasting friendships, and grow in their relationship with God. Our Kids' services incorporate praise, worship, honest conversations and illustrated messages that explain God's Word in a relatable way. We strive to be a place where children of all ages and all backgrounds are loved, welcomed, and invited into an atmosphere where they can encounter the love of God.  We hope SC Kids is just the beginning of a life-long, character-building, exciting journey with Jesus for your kids.

What We're Teaching: 

Power of the SPIRIT

God promises His Holy Spirit to every person who trusts in Jesus. The Spirit isn’t reserved only for so-called super Christians who’ve been walking with God for decades. The Holy Spirit is for everyone who believes! There’s no such thing as a junior-sized version of the Holy Spirit for junior-sized followers of Jesus. The very same Spirit who raised Christ from the dead fills—and leads—the kids in your ministry! As you explore stories of the Holy Spirit’s arrival and work within the early church, marvel with your kids at the truth that the Spirit dwells in them, helps them, and gives them strength and boldness!
This month's memory verse: But you will receive power when the Holy Spirit comes on you; and you will be my witnesses in Jerusalem, and in all Judea and Samaria, and to the ends of the earth. - Acts 1:8 NIV
Week 1: The lesson about the Great Commission and Jesus returning to heaven highlights the promise of the Holy Spirit. Scripture Passages: Matthew 28 and Acts 1

Week 2: Learning about Pentecost will teach us that Holy Spirit empowers us to share the Good News of the Gospel. Scripture Passage: Acts 2

Week 3: As we study the role of Holy Spirit, we'll understand that He helps and guides us. Scripture Passages: Luke 11, John 14 and Galatians 5

Week 4: The lesson about Peter and John before the Sanhedrin teaches us that Holy Spirit helps us be bold. Scripture Passages: Acts 3-4

Week 5: Learning about Peter and Cornelius will teach us that Holy Spirit is for everyone who believes. Scripture Passage: Acts 10

Week 6: In studying the Armor of God, we'll see that the Holy Spirit gives us strength. Scripture Passage: Ephesians 6
